Programacion En Pic C

Páginas: 5 (1160 palabras) Publicado: 3 de octubre de 2012
Laboratorio N°2
Representación de un teclado matricial 4x4


Deisy Briyid Daza Morales161002708Ingeniería electrónica, Universidad de los Llanos Villavicencio, ColombiaDeisydaza11.04@gmail.com | Jairo Alejandro Valero Rodríguez161002737Ingeniería electrónica, Universidad de los Llanos Villavicencio, ColombiaJaironex11@hotmail.com |

Resumen-- en el presente informe sehablará acerca de la utilidad y funcionalidad que poseen algunos periféricos para el mundo de los micro controladores, tales como el teclado matricial y la pantalla lcd, explicando detalladamente el funcionamiento de estos a partir de sus librerías y la modificación de las misma, para obtener lo pedido en el laboratorio.

Palabras clave— Lcd, librerías, micro controlador,teclado matricial.

Abstract …In this report will talk about the usefulness and functionality that have some peripherals to the world of micro controllers, such as matrix keyboard and LCD screen, explaining in detail the operation of these from their libraries and modifying the same, to get the order in the laboratory.

Keywords— Lcd, bookstores, micro controller, keyboard matrix.

introducciónLos seres humanos siempre buscan la representación de todo lo que se encuentra a su alrededor, sobre todo en la era de la tecnología se trata de suplir digitalmente esta necesidad, lo mas común es la visualización en los LCD o pantallas de cristal liquido que tienen como función la representación alfanumérica proveniente de cualquier equipo electrónico de manera fácil y económica, en este casode un teclado matricial de 4x4, los cuales funcionan como un conjunto de interruptores, es decir, cuando se oprime una tecla, se denota una conexión entre columna y fila.
Desarrollo del artículo

Para llevar este proyecto a cabo, se necesitan unos conceptos básicos para su mayor entendimiento como Lcd, teclado matricial, micro controlador, librerías lcd y kbd lógica combinacional entreotras. Explicaremos los conceptos relevantes a continuación y luego continuáremos con el procedimiento

LCD [1]

Fig.1

Fig.1
Los monitores de cristal líquido (Fig.1), o LCD ("Liquid Crystal Display"), están formados por 2 capas conductoras transparentes y en medio un material especial cristalino (cristal líquido). Cuando la corriente circula entre los electrodos transparentes con la forma arepresentar (por ejemplo, un segmento de un número) el material cristalino se reorienta alterando su transparencia. Los LCD tienen excelente contraste y nitidez. Además de ahorrar hasta un 40% de energía.

MICROCONTROLADOR [2]

Fig.2

Fig.2
 Es un circuito integrado programable, capaz de ejecutar las órdenes grabadas en su memoria. Estácompuesto de varios bloques funcionales, los cuales cumplen una tarea específica. Un micro controlador (Fig.2), incluye en su interior las tres principales unidades funcionales de una computadora: unidad central de procesamiento, memoria y periféricos de entrada/ salida.

Fig.3

Fig.3

TECLADO MATRICIAL

Las entradas a través depulsadores son muy comunes en los sistemas con micro controladores [3], para trabajar con una mayor información o información alfanumérica. Por ende se hace necesario trabajar con diferentes magnitudes en un teclado matricial: 1x4, 3x4, 4x4.
Donde [4] este es un simple arreglo de botones conectados en filas y colúmnas, de modo que se pueden leer varios botones con el mínimo número de pinesrequeridos.

PROCEDIMIENTO

Para lograr nuestro objetivo, se necesitaron dos etapas, las cuales se describirán a continuación:

1) Modificación en la asignación de pines para el manejo del periférico lcd.
En esta etapa de desarrollo no se contaba con el problema en la implementación física del circuito, ya que estábamos compartiendo pines del puerto B, tanto para...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• PIC PROGRAMACION EN C
  • Programación de PIC en C
  • Programación de Pic
  • programacion de pic
  • pic c
  • Pic programacion
  • Ejemplos programacion en c para pic
  • programación c++

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S